Women's Soccer
Duchon Named Player of the Week for Second Time
For Immediate Release:
Sept. 23, 2007
RICHMOND, Ind. — Earlham College first-year Karman Duchon was honored on Sunday by the North Coast Athletic Conference as the Player of the Week for women’s soccer.
This is the second time this season that Duchon (Decatur, GA/Decatur) received the award after also getting it on Sept. 4. She scored two goals and added three assists as the Quakers defeated Adrian College 4-0 and beat St. Mary-of-the-Woods College 5-1 during the past week.
Saturday’s victory over St. Mary-of-the-Woods was the fourth win in a row for Earlham, which is the most consecutive victories for the Quakers since the 1999 team won four straight.
The Quakers (6-1-1) travel to Manchester College on Tuesday. The non-conference contest begins at 4:30 p.m.
